summaryrefslogtreecommitdiffstats
path: root/perl-install/standalone/net_applet
diff options
context:
space:
mode:
authorOlivier Blin <oblin@mandriva.org>2005-07-13 03:48:39 +0000
committerOlivier Blin <oblin@mandriva.org>2005-07-13 03:48:39 +0000
commitbea81cf1e33daca67dc01afcdf1956b445ae47c1 (patch)
tree5a2d9a335d73a1b7468ec10bca49773d3ac97d1b /perl-install/standalone/net_applet
parentcddf386defea9fcb3900b7b46337b4cc96df6668 (diff)
downloaddrakx-bea81cf1e33daca67dc01afcdf1956b445ae47c1.tar
drakx-bea81cf1e33daca67dc01afcdf1956b445ae47c1.tar.gz
drakx-bea81cf1e33daca67dc01afcdf1956b445ae47c1.tar.bz2
drakx-bea81cf1e33daca67dc01afcdf1956b445ae47c1.tar.xz
drakx-bea81cf1e33daca67dc01afcdf1956b445ae47c1.zip
use dbus_object;
Diffstat (limited to 'perl-install/standalone/net_applet')
-rw-r--r--perl-install/standalone/net_applet4
1 files changed, 3 insertions, 1 deletions
diff --git a/perl-install/standalone/net_applet b/perl-install/standalone/net_applet
index 37300d5a5..14ba43e6f 100644
--- a/perl-install/standalone/net_applet
+++ b/perl-install/standalone/net_applet
@@ -30,6 +30,8 @@ my $current_md5 = md5file($prog_name);
my $net = {};
my $watched_interface;
+my $dbus = dbus_object::system_bus();
+
$SIG{HUP} = sub {
print "received SIGHUP, reloading network configuration\n";
checkNetworkForce();
@@ -110,7 +112,7 @@ my $interactive_cb;
my @attacks_queue;
if ($enable_activefw) {
- $activefw = network::activefw->new(sub {
+ $activefw = network::activefw->new($dbus, sub {
my ($_con, $msg) = @_;
handle_attack($msg->get_args_list) if $msg->get_member eq "Attack";
});